Spatial resolution refers to the size of the smallest object that can be detected in an image. Landsat data, for example, has a 30m resolution, meaning each pixel stands for a 30m x 30m area on the ground. The grid cell s in high resolution data, such as those produced by digital aerial imaging, or by the ikonos satellite, correspond to ground areas as small or smaller than one square meter. Onemeter spatial resolution means each pixel image represents an area of one square meter in the ground spatial resolution the size of a pixel that is recorded in a raster image typically pixels may correspond to square areas ranging in side length.
